Piana
Piana is a hamlet in Ponte, Province of Benevento, Campania and has about 14 residents. Piana is situated nearby to the locality Limata, as well as near the hamlet Santa Maria la Strada.Places of Interest

Santa Maria in Gruptis
Ruins
Photo: Wikimedia, CC BY-SA 3.0.
Santa Maria in Gruptis is a former abbey located in the comune of Vitulano, in the Campania region of Southern Italy. Founded in the 10th century and used by several monastic orders, it was deconsecrated in 1705, and is currently in ruins. Santa Maria in Gruptis is situated 3½ km south of Piana.

Telese Terme
Village
Photo: silvio sicignano, CC BY-SA 2.0.
Telese Terme, called simply Telese until 1991, is a city, comune and former episcopal seat in the Province of Benevento, in the Campania region of southern Italy. It is located in the valley of the Calore, well known for its sulfuric hot springs. Telese Terme is situated 8 km west of Piana.
